Important Aspects for Contemporary Businesses

In the present dynamic corporate environment, having an effective business phone system is essential for facilitating communication and securing smooth operations. One of the key features to consider is call forwarding, which allows calls to be redirected to multiple numbers or devices. This is particularly helpful for companies with distributed employees or those working in multiple locations, making sure that no call goes unattended.

Another significant feature is voicemail integration integration. This option enables users to receive voicemail messages straight in their email, making it more convenient to manage communications. This feature saves time and helps businesses keep organized, as messages can be prioritized and retrieved from anywhere, allowing for efficient follow-up and response.

In conclusion, a reliable business phone system should feature conferencing capabilities. This allows teams to conduct meetings with clients or colleagues no matter their locational place. Options such as video calls and screen sharing enhance collaboration and improve efficiency, making it an essential tool for contemporary businesses looking to thrive in a dynamic landscape.

Benefits of Cloud Phone Systems

Internet-based phone systems offer substantial flexibility for businesses of all sizes. With the ability to access phone services from any location with an internet connection, employees can communicate efficiently whether they are in the office, telecommuting, or traveling. This flexibility is particularly advantageous for businesses that have adopted flexible working arrangements or operate across various locations, as it eliminates the constraints of traditional on-premises systems.

Another advantage of cloud-based enterprise phone systems is their cost-effectiveness. Businesses can save on the initial costs of hardware and installation, as many cloud solutions operate on a recurring payment model that includes maintenance and upgrades. This not only reduces upfront expenses but also allows companies to scale their services easily as they grow or as their needs change, providing a business advantage in a competitive marketplace.

Moreover, cloud-based systems often come equipped with advanced features that enhance communication and productivity. Features such as call forwarding, voicemail-to-email, and syncing with customer relationship management software streamline operations and improve customer interactions. This system empowers teams to work together more effectively and respond to client needs promptly, leading to improved overall service and satisfaction.

Linkages with Additional Corporate Applications

Combining your corporate phone system with alternative crucial resources can significantly improve productivity and streamline processes. Modern corporate phone systems offer integration with client relationship management (CRM) applications, permitting employees to get client data and engagement records immediately from their phone system. This connection enables more personalized service and improves the effectiveness of interactions by reducing the effort spent shifting between platforms.

Moreover, connections with cooperation tools such as team messaging platforms and virtual conferencing resources can revolutionize how teams interact. By bringing voice communications, video meetings, and real-time messaging together, team members can work together seamlessly, whether in the office or functioning remotely. These integrated communication systems not only foster better collaboration but also help ensure a steady flow of information within the business.

Additionally, enterprise telephone solutions that link with data analysis and reporting tools can deliver important information into telephone trends and employee efficiency. This information allows companies to pinpoint aspects for improvement, refine client interactions, and implement data-driven choices. By utilizing these connections, organizations can enhance client contentment and eventually boost expansion through more successful engagement strategies.
